What does SLA mean in Governmental & Military

SLA meaning is defined below:

superlight ablative
Categories of this acronyms

Particularly in

ADVERTISEMENT

Was it useful?

What does SLA mean? It stands for superlight ablative

Most popular questions

What does SLA stand for?


SLA stands for "superlight ablative"

How to abbreviate "superlight ablative"?


"superlight ablative" can be abbreviated as SLA

What is the meaning of SLA abbreviation?


The meaning of SLA abbreviation is "superlight ablative"

What does SLA mean?


SLA as abbreviation means "superlight ablative"